disaffected russians looking to start a new life abroad. another train pulls into the station, bringing people to safety. most passengers are russians, not ukrainians. the train from st. petersburg to helsinki takes about 3 and a half hours. it's been booked out for days. flights between russia and western europe have been suspended. most of the arrivals here want nothing more than to observe political and economic developments in russia from a safe distance. and the goal, worse for my room, a decision to find the drawn to where i go. fade for more time. only russian passengers with a valid visa or residency permit can enter the european union. alina,

who is the translator left russia the day after russia began its assault on ukraine . she's staying with friends in helsinki, but her visa expires in 3 months. and it's uncertain whether she will be able to remain in finland. she is deeply shocked by what has happened. i am crying and then sleeping. seen it since it's all started. that's how i sheila cio matter, to sure that i'm then going back. i'm not sure if i will be able to leave. oh, but this fear in russia criticizing the war can land you in jail, which is why more and more russians are leaving the country. finland has welcomed them with open arms. more and more people here have come to see russian president vladimir putin as a threat to finland to finland shares

a 1300 kilometer border with russia before finland was proud of its neutrality. now for the 1st time ever, a majority of fin support joining nato was filled with why not? i think it's important to try and avoid honey but also to kind of free life vasta back on you for i'm you go so you may have to deal with muscle levels. the finish government does not want to cause alarm, but the country has gone on high alert. this film reminds the public to be ready for any eventuality. this memorial is dedicated to those who died in what is remembered as the way a war of 1939 tiny finland fought back against the soviet union. despite heavy losses, finland managed to ward off

a soviet occupation. joining nato could act as a deterrent. but russia has threatened political and military consequences. finland has not yet applied for nato membership. but there are signs that it's under consideration. finland's foreign minister is a guest at nato summits. here in helsinki, alina feel safe from what is happening in russia for now. but she worries about the future. ah,
